			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p> Google also announced last week, the daily activation of Android-based phone system also reached to growing rapidly and is much higher than the mid-May.  If someone talks about the smart phone industry, the people might easily think of Apple and Google as these both are leading the wave of competition in this field. </p>
<p>Apple has just launched  iPhone 4 mobile phones, and within three days  the launch of this mobile phone sales broke the 1.7 million record bar, Google announced its Android operating system running the number of daily active cell phone as high as 160,000.</p>
<p>Clearly, Apple and Google, have certainly attracted high-profile act of the industry, but the fact is that the two companies are still chasing the North American market leader in mobile phone manufacturer RIM Corporation. According to market research firm Nielsen published data, RIM&#8217;s BlackBerry handsets accounted for 35% of U.S. market share, and Apple iPhone mobile phone share of the market share is 28%, The market shares based on Android operating system phones is about 9%.</p>
<p>Of course, the data from the current perspective, RIM is still first  in the U.S. market , but this data is implicitly built a significant decline in market share, RIM fact  is that 5 years ago, RIM&#8217;s mobile phones accounted for 50 % market share, but the growing pressure of competition, under the situation, its market share is declining.</p>
<p>Gartner, another market analysis also predicted that in 2012 it is expected that Android will become the world&#8217;s leading race courses (Symbian) after the second best-selling smartphone platform, but Apple&#8217;s iPhone will be followed by the first resident and is currently in second place. RIM global market share will slip to fourth place.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>After Google Android and iPhones Spotify is now expanding its online music service for cellphones having symbian OS.</strong></p>
<p>Spotify made the announcement today for its<strong> spotify for symbian </strong>application. With this launch spotify mobile will be available sets ranging from 6220 Classic, E71 and 5800 XpressMusic models to popular Sony Ericsson and Samsung smartphones, such as the Samsung GT-I8910 Omnia HD and Sony Ericsson Satio.<img src="http://whitehatfirm.com/news/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/symbian-phones-150x150.png" alt="symbian-phones" title="symbian-phones" width="150" height="150" class="alignright size-thumbnail wp-image-950" /></p>
<p>Spotify Mobile can stream over WiFi or 2.5G/3G to play music through your mobile phone and it also facilitates it’s users to let them store playlists in offline mode.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>From Mobile making Samsung mobile is up to something new. Samsung is taking itself into straight competition with Apple, Google, Windows, and Symbian with the announcement of the launch of its new open operating mobile platform Bada.</strong></p>
<p>Synonym to Ocean in Korean language<strong> Bada </strong>would enables a richer user experience in applications on Samsung mobile devices. Samsung has developed bada to make rich and connected application-experiences available to everyone. It includes next generation next generation UI framework with feature sets and design elements that facilitate leading-edge user interfaces for every bada application.</p>
<p>Samsung describes its key features as<br />
•	Integrate support for <strong>service-oriented features</strong>: to enable development of connected application.<br />
•	Integrates supports for common experience and functions across applications for <strong>extensible core functions </strong>like dialer, messaging, and address book.</p>
<p>For <strong>developers</strong> BADA site contains development tips, tools, documentation, and tech support resources and also provides the development forum to the developer community.</p>
<p>According to the<a href="http://www.bada.com/"> bada Web site</a>, the first bada-powered mobile phone is expected to be introduced in the first half of next year. Sale of bada applications will start at the Samsung Application Store in the same period.</p>
<p>Users will also eventually be able to download Bada applications over the air from Samsung&#8217;s Application Store. </p>
<p>Samsung also said the Bada software development kit will be released in December, and handsets with the OS are expected to arrive in 2010. </p>
